Jane Eagland

Born in Essex, Jane Eagland taught English in secondary schools for many years. After doing an MA in creative writing, she now divides her time between writing and tutoring. Wildthorn is her first novel, inpsired by true stories of women who were incarcerated in asylums in the nineteenth century. Jane lives in Lancashire, in a house with a view of the fells.

Bear's days are very dull, because he has nothing to do but listen to Dog talking about bones. But he knows that he is Ellie's favourite toy, so it is all right. He looks forward to the end of the day, when she will come back and tell him all about school. Then Ellie has to take her favourite toy to school - and she takes Dog! How could she? Ellie catches Bear sobbing that night, and she explains that he was too big to go on the bus, but she will take him next time. And so Bear does go to school after all, and in the vote for the best toy - he finds himself second best, just like Dog.
